Pricing Analysis
Price comparison per million tokens
For input processing, Claude 3 Sonnet ($3.00/1M tokens) is 30.0x more expensive than Qwen3 32B ($0.10/1M tokens).
For output processing, Claude 3 Sonnet ($15.00/1M tokens) is 50.0x more expensive than Qwen3 32B ($0.30/1M tokens).
In conclusion, Claude 3 Sonnet is more expensive than Qwen3 32B.*
* Using a 3:1 ratio of input to output tokens
Context Window
Maximum input and output token capacity
Claude 3 Sonnet accepts 200,000 input tokens compared to Qwen3 32B's 128,000 tokens. Claude 3 Sonnet can generate longer responses up to 200,000 tokens, while Qwen3 32B is limited to 128,000 tokens.

License
Usage and distribution terms
Claude 3 Sonnet is licensed under a proprietary license, while Qwen3 32B uses Apache 2.0.
License differences may affect how you can use these models in commercial or open-source projects.
